Markey unseats Musgrave
The Denver Post  November 5th
Democratic challenger thrashes three-term incumbent in evolving, sprawling district
An era ended Tuesday night in Colorado's sprawling 4th Congressional District as Democratic challenger Betsy Markey soundly defeated incumbent Republican Marilyn Musgrave.

Fiction:

“Betsy Markey actually got rich on non-competitive Halliburton style contracts,”

Truth:

News outlets have completely discredited this claim.  In truth, the vast majority of contracts awarded to Syscom Systems, the small business that Betsy and her husband Jim built from their basement up, were won in an open, competitive bidding process. 

The CBS4 Reality Check actually noted:  “This claim is highly misleading. First, it implies that Markey's family-owned company, Syscom Systems-which sells data processing equipment, benefitted from the kind of alleged cronyism associated with Halliburton during the Iraq war. Yet, the Musgrave campaign offers nothing more than innuendo to support this contention.”

Fiction:

 “"if Betsy Markey used her congressional job to more then double her companies contracts what will she do as you Congresswoman"

 “We already know Betsy Markey’s family business doubled its government contracts after she landed a Senate job.”

Truth:

The truth is that Betsy Markey’s position working as a regional director for Senator Salazar based in Fort Collins had no effect on the contracts that Syscom received from the federal government.  Press accounts agree that Syscom saw no significant spike in government contract work between 2005 and 2007, the years that Betsy worked for Salazar.

In fact, the Fort Collins Coloradoan wrote: “Although Syscom's federal contracts were higher in 2005-2007 than in the 2002-2004 period cited by the Musgrave campaign, they were similar to federal awards the company received in 2000 and 2001, years before Salazar was elected to the Senate.  Other companies providing similar services to Syscom - server-based fax systems - also saw similar increases in federal contracts in the 2005-2007 time frame cited by Musgrave.”

Fiction:

 “Now scandal: according to the Senate Ethics Committee, Markey’s company could not accept government contracts while she worked for the Senate

“But records prove Markey violated ethics rules…”

Truth:

There was no ruling from the Senate Ethics Committee that said that Syscom could not receive government contracts while Betsy Markey worked for Senator Salazar.  This is a completely fabricated claim by the Musgrave campaign.  In fact, the Senate Ethics Committee ruled that Markey could continue on as a part owner of Syscom, but Betsy decided to divest her share in the company to her husband to avoid even the appearance of impropriety.  Records actually show that Markey went above and beyond what was required of her and that it was Betsy herself who approached the Ethics Committee for a ruling.  Furthermore, a spokesperson for the General Services Administration (GSA) told reporters that there was absolutely no proof of any wrongdoing on Markey’s part in the federal contract rewarding process.

The Fort Collins Coloradoan noted: “Salazar sought guidance from the Senate Ethics Committee in September 2005, and was told about three weeks later that Markey’s ownership of Syscom didn’t violate Senate rules. Markey said she wanted to err on the side of caution and turned over her majority ownership to her husband shortly after the ethics ruling.”

Fiction:

“…and has lied to the government and us regarding the ownership of her business.”

Truth:

The bottom line: Betsy Markey completely divested her ownership of Syscom Services to her husband on November 1, 2005.  Records show this to be true and news outlets have reported that the Musgrave campaign’s libelous claim reported above is false.

The Loveland Connection recently reported: “Democratic congressional candidate Betsy Markey owned 51.4 percent of her family's business from Nov. 15, 1997, until Nov. 1, 2005, when she turned over her ownership stake to her husband, according to documents reviewed by the Coloradoan.
